Sequence ToU128
std/conversion/vector/f32::ToU128
Parameters
↳ var pos_infinity: u128 = 340282366920938463463374607431768211455
↳ var neg_infinity: u128 = 0
↳ var nan: u128 = 0
Inputs
⇥ value: Stream<Vec<f32>>
Outputs
↦ value: Stream<Vec<u128>>
Convert stream of Vec<f32>
into Vec<u128>
one.
Vec<f32>
gets converted into Vec<u128>
, and the resulting vectors are send through stream in continuity.
Every f32
is truncated to fit into the u128
, and in case floating-point value does
not describe a real number:
pos_infinity
is used whenf32
is a positive infinity,neg_infinity
is used whenf32
is a negative infinity,nan
is used whenf32
is not a number.